1、print
awk '{print $1,$2}' emp.dat 打印出的$1和$2以OFS作为分隔符分隔。打印之后换行
awk '{print $1 $2}' emp.dat 打印出的$1和$2中间没有任何分隔符,即两个结果是紧挨着的。打印之后换行
2、printf
awk '{printf("%-3s\n",$2}' emp.dat printf用于格式化打印出信息,并且不换行。
3、在awk的pattern Action 有较多内容的情况下,可以将其保存为一个单独的文件,然后在命令行上执行
awk -f file.awk emp.dat的形式来执行
阅读(576) | 评论(0) | 转发(0) |